HB 5227 Connecticut House · 2024 Regular Session

AN ACT CONCERNING THE RELEASE OF CERTAIN LIENS OF THE DEPARTMENT OF ENERGY AND ENVIRONMENTAL PROTECTION.

This bill requires the Department of Energy and Environmental Protection to remove liens from properties within 60 days after they are paid off or otherwise resolved. The law applies specifically to liens where the department is the party claiming the debt, ensuring that property titles are cleared promptly once the financial obligation is satisfied. By adding this new subsection to existing statutes, the legislation aims to prevent liens from lingering on properties longer than necessary after the debt has been settled.
